I made this really cute tea cup with Claire's amazing Tea Cup Template. ( There is no way I could ever think that one up on my own!) You can buy it here.I used the gorgeous Festive Foliage stamp set to make my cup. I love that set. Everything looks better with pretty pinecones! I actually used white cardstock but got it all inky with some PTI chai tea ink. The ink for the images is Palette new leaf and memento jumbo java. The liner is some old green patterned paper. I have no idea of manufacturer.
One more view of the tea cup. This template is easier than it looks but I am not going to swear its easy, LOL! I am a little challenged when it comes the fussy cutting and that handle was hard! But it was fun and I do look forward to making another.

Festive Foilage


Good Morning Blogland! Today I have another Christmas card. This one is easy to mass produce and easy to mail. The focal image is from Waltzingmouse stamps, a set called Festive Foilage. The sentiment is from PTI, Tree Trimming Trio. I used some tea stain ink on the edges and brilliance ink on the stamps. Trimmed out the panel and mounted it on some Pinefeather green card. Thats all there is to it! Happy Thursday!
